What is JB Weld?
JB Weld is a two-part epoxy adhesive that was first developed in 1969 as a solution for tough bonding situations. Over the years, it has gained a reputation as an industrial-strength adhesive that can bond metals, plastics, ceramics, and more. The product is widely used in automotive repairs, plumbing projects, home crafting, and much more.
The traditional JB Weld consists of a resin and a hardener, which, when mixed together, initiate a chemical reaction that forms a very strong bond. The adhesive can withstand high temperatures and offer resistance to various chemicals, making it an ideal choice for numerous applications.

FDA Regulations and JB Weld
The Food and Drug Administration (FDA) regulates products that come into contact with food in the United States. For a product to be considered food safe, it generally must meet specific criteria and be composed of substances that are deemed non-toxic and safe for food contact.
At present, JB Weld is not FDA-approved for food contact applications. The manufacturer explicitly states that while JB Weld can be used for a variety of repair needs, it should not be used in applications involving direct food contact or in scenarios where food might be consumed from the bonded surface.
Reasons Why JB Weld Should Not Be Used for Food Applications
Chemical Composition: The chemicals present in JB Weld’s formulation may leach into food or beverages, creating potential health risks. Some of these chemicals could be harmful, particularly in larger quantities or with prolonged exposure.
Lack of FDA Approval: As mentioned, JB Weld does not carry FDA approval for food contact. This indicates that sufficient tests have not been conducted to guarantee its safety in these situations.
Long Cure Time: While JB Weld sets strong over time, the curing process can take several hours to a day, during which the adhesive may release fumes or chemicals that are not food-safe.

Alternatives to JB Weld for Food-Related Applications
If you are searching for an adhesive for food-related projects, consider alternatives that are specifically designed to be food safe. Here’s a closer look at some of these options:
1. Food-Safe Epoxy
Several epoxies are available on the market that are specifically formulated to comply with FDA regulations for food safety. These epoxies typically contain non-toxic ingredients and are ideal for applications involving food contact.
2. Silicone Sealants
Food-safe silicone sealants offer flexibility and durability. They can withstand temperature changes and provide a waterproof seal, making them suitable for kitchen use.
3. PVA Glue
Polyvinyl acetate (PVA) glue, commonly known as wood glue, is another option. It is non-toxic and food safe once dry and is useful in food-related woodworking projects.

What types of JB Weld products are available?
JB Weld offers a variety of products tailored to different repair needs. The flagship product is the original JB Weld epoxy, ideal for bonding metals, plastics, and ceramics. Other variations include JB Kwik Weld, which sets faster, and JB Plastic Bonder, designed specifically for plastic materials. Each product has its unique formulation to optimize performance for specific applications.
However, regardless of the product variation, caution is still warranted regarding food safety. While some JB Weld products may withstand high temperatures, they are not marketed as safe for food contact. Therefore, always check the label and opt for food-safe alternatives when working with items associated with food.
How long does JB Weld take to cure?
JB Weld typically requires around 4 to 6 hours to set and achieve its initial bonding strength. However, a full cure time of 15 to 24 hours is recommended for the bond to reach its maximum strength. Curing times can vary depending on factors such as temperature and humidity, so it’s essential to consider these conditions when applying the adhesive.
It’s crucial to allow adequate curing time to ensure the repair is durable and strong. Rushing the process may lead to weaker bonds and unreliable repairs, so it’s advisable not to use items bonded with JB Weld until the full curing period is complete.
Can you use JB Weld in a high-temperature environment?
JB Weld is designed to withstand high temperatures, with some products rated for temperatures up to 500°F (260°C) when cured. This property makes JB Weld suitable for certain high-heat applications, such as repairing exhaust systems or metal components exposed to heat. However, it’s important to ensure that you are using the correct product variant for such environments.
